Beef Look to Start Run to Playoffs in Peoria

May 26, 2006 - United Indoor Football Association (UIF)
Omaha Beef News Release


Omaha, Nebraska - The Omaha Beef of United Indoor Football (UIF) will be looking to get back to their winning ways this Saturday as the team travels to Peoria, IL to battle the Peoria Rough Riders. Omaha needs to get a victory to stay in the playoff hunt with only seven games to play.

Omaha lost another heartbreaker last week after coming back to tie the game in the 4th quarter. Bloomington scored a touchdown with 38 seconds left to secure the victory. The Beef have held second half leads or been tied in each of their last four losses. The Beef now find themselves in a logjam at 3-5 for the final spot in the playoffs. Omaha scored their 3rd most points of the season (40) last week as RJ Rollins added two more touchdowns to bring his league-leading total of touchdowns to 16. The Beef offense is averaging 37.1 points per game this season, which ranks 6th in the UIF.

Linebacker Chris Eads added 7.5 tackles last week to bring his season total to 58.5, which ranks 4th in the league. The Beef defense has been the rock of the team all season long as they are allowing an average of 37.3 points per game, which ranks 4th in the UIF.

Peoria's offense also scored more points than average last week as the Rough Riders scored their second most points of the season (45) last week. Peoria's offense is averaging a league-worst 33.1 points per game. Wide receiver Phil Taylor Jr. is in charge of the offense by hauling in 31 receptions and scoring 9 touchdowns this season. Linebacker Blue Aldridge leads the defense with 33.5 tackles.

Beef Head Coach Robert Fuller says "Peoria played very well at Ohio Valley and they have added several key players so we are expecting a tough game on the road. They have some exciting skill position players and they have some guys on defense that will hit you. Coach Goodwin will have his team ready."
